The Expression of Osteoclastogenesis-Associated Factors and Osteoblast Response to Osteolytic Prostate Cancer Cells
BACKGROUND: Prostate cancer (PCa) has a propensity to metastasize to bone. Tumor cells replace bone marrow and can elicit an osteoblastic, osteolytic, or mixed bone response. Our objective was to elucidate the mechanisms and key factors involved in promoting osteoclastogenesis in PCa bone metastasis...
